The Wilson Arts & Entertainment District is delighted to be welcoming the FIRST gallery to Historic Downtown Centralia - the Centralia Visual Arts Center & Gallery - slated to open in May 2009! The CVAC is a newly formed non-profit with the goal of serving and supporting regional artists through changing exhibitions, creating an arts based community education program, workshops, lectures, poetry readings, recitals and becoming a "third place" for community gathering.
